Supervision
The initial day at doggy childcare usually begins with a meet-and-greet where personnel will certainly evaluate your family pet's convenience level with other pet dogs and evaluate their social skills. This analysis is made via a gradual intro procedure in which the staff will carefully manage the pups.
This makes sure that each dog is risk-free and able to have fun with others in an environment that has been made for safety and health and wellness methods. Daycare facilities must additionally have a clear communication process for family pets' proprietors and staff, as this enables fast resolution of any issues that may emerge during playtime.
Supervision degrees might consist of constant physical existence by a skilled childcare and boarding staff in the rooms of pet dogs playing off-leash, routine monitoring (checking know the dogs occasionally) or remote supervision. The level of supervision will rely on the dimension and personalities of the dogs, in addition to the design of the center.

Socialization
Canine daycares provide a fantastic way to help dogs become accustomed to other dogs in a safe and structured setting. This is an important part of socializing, as lots of pet dog owners can not regularly take their pups out on walks or interact with them in a natural environment. This can lead to behavioral concerns such as too much barking or eating.
Ask potential canine daycares regarding their training programs. How do they address simple troubles such as barking, raising and pet dog fights? Avoid facilities that make use of penalty techniques such as spray bottles, clapping or kneeing in the chest. These create stress and anxiety for the pet dog in addition to the other staff members that might be present.

Wellness & Inoculation Requirements
In addition to a day-to-day checkup, lots of trusted daycares call for all pet dogs to be fully vaccinated prior to they can play. Injections are preparations of either eliminated or changed microorganisms that are offered to a canine so that its body immune system discovers to fight them. This gives security from the diseases brought on by these bacteria and protects various other pet dogs in the facility.
Core vaccinations include distemper (also called canine distemper), rabies, canine liver disease, parainfluenza, parvovirus and leptospirosis. Additional non-core inoculations may include the canine flu vaccine, a kennel coughing booster and a Lyme illness shot.

Fees
Pet dog daycare is a useful resource for active animal moms and dads, offering their pet dogs with much-needed socialization and exercise while they're gone during the day. Several day cares additionally provide added services such as pet grooming and overnight boarding.
The rate range for pet dog daycares differs widely, depending upon the type of services and services provided. Nonetheless, many centers charge an everyday fee for a full-day of treatment, which typically includes the price of meals and monitored pause.
The typical price for a daycare is around $40 to $60, however this can climb up higher relying on the types of activities and solutions offered. Lots of daycares provide plan rates, which are normally a price cut over the routine price. These plans are offered to both existing daycare clients and brand-new ones.
